TY - GEN
T1 - Enabling cooperative computing for android-based mobile platforms
AU - Lin, Tin Yen
AU - Chen, Jing
AU - Liu, Jian Hong
N1 - Publisher Copyright:
© 2016 IEEE.
PY - 2016/8/16
Y1 - 2016/8/16
N2 - Mobile devices nowadays has become more popular than ever, but mobile applications still suffer from limitations of available resources imposed by the platforms. Offloading mobile application to a virtual machine deployed on cloud server is one feasible solution. However, this method appears to be effective only for the cases of running stand-alone applications and is not able to achieve cooperative computing across platform boundary. In attempting to address the issue, we consider cross-platform IPC (Inter-Process Communication) to be an essential capability toward achieving cooperative computing at application level and expand the IPC mechanism of Android-based system to be the foundation of building a collaborative and cooperative working environment. This new IPC mechanism is called XBinder. The main contribution of this work is providing a way for mobile applications to cooperate with local or remote services without developing complicate network transmission mechanism. Mobile applications are able to effectively and efficiently communicate with services which execute either on local node or remote node.
AB - Mobile devices nowadays has become more popular than ever, but mobile applications still suffer from limitations of available resources imposed by the platforms. Offloading mobile application to a virtual machine deployed on cloud server is one feasible solution. However, this method appears to be effective only for the cases of running stand-alone applications and is not able to achieve cooperative computing across platform boundary. In attempting to address the issue, we consider cross-platform IPC (Inter-Process Communication) to be an essential capability toward achieving cooperative computing at application level and expand the IPC mechanism of Android-based system to be the foundation of building a collaborative and cooperative working environment. This new IPC mechanism is called XBinder. The main contribution of this work is providing a way for mobile applications to cooperate with local or remote services without developing complicate network transmission mechanism. Mobile applications are able to effectively and efficiently communicate with services which execute either on local node or remote node.
UR - http://www.scopus.com/inward/record.url?scp=84986205291&partnerID=8YFLogxK
UR - http://www.scopus.com/inward/citedby.url?scp=84986205291&partnerID=8YFLogxK
U2 - 10.1109/IS3C.2016.195
DO - 10.1109/IS3C.2016.195
M3 - Conference contribution
AN - SCOPUS:84986205291
T3 - Proceedings - 2016 IEEE International Symposium on Computer, Consumer and Control, IS3C 2016
SP - 763
EP - 766
BT - Proceedings - 2016 IEEE International Symposium on Computer, Consumer and Control, IS3C 2016
PB - Institute of Electrical and Electronics Engineers Inc.
T2 - 2016 IEEE International Symposium on Computer, Consumer and Control, IS3C 2016
Y2 - 4 July 2016 through 6 July 2016
ER -